Laparoscopic Adrenalectomy: The Optimal Surgical Approach

Abstract
Background and Purpose: Laparoscopic adrenalectomy has emerged as the treatment of choice for most adrenal surgical disorders. We describe our experience with 176 laparoscopic operations. Patients and Methods: The patients were treated for hyperaldosteronism (N = 62), pheochromocytoma (N = 43), "incidentaloma" (N = 21), Cushing's syndrome (N = 20), suspected adrenal metastasis (N = 16), Cushing's disease (N = 8), adrenal hemorrhage (N = 3), or virilizing tumor (N = 1). In 154 of the 176 laparoscopic operations, a lateral transabdominal approach (15 bilateral, 76 left, and 63 right) was used. In the remaining 22, a posterior laparoscopic approach (3 bilateral, 10 left, and 9 right) was used. Results: The average total operating time for unilateral laparoscopic adrenalectomy was 2.8 hours, and for bilateral adrenalectomy, it was 5.2 hours. The mean tumor size was 4.6 cm (range 1-15 cm). There was no significant difference in operating time according to the tumor size. The average length of hospitalization was 1.7 days (range 1-9 days). The perioperative complication rate was 5.1%. There were no conversions to an open procedure. The operating time, length of hospitalization, and perioperative complication rate were stable over the period.
